fix fixup

This commit is contained in:
2016-04-20 03:24:29 +02:00
parent 2248cd4134
commit 8adda2a10f
+13
View File
@@ -151,13 +151,26 @@ class Host:
except: except:
self.hdwcounts = [[self.doesack,self.upcount],[self.doesack,self.upcount],[self.doesack,self.upcount]] self.hdwcounts = [[self.doesack,self.upcount],[self.doesack,self.upcount],[self.doesack,self.upcount]]
try:
self.addr=self.addr4
except:
pass
try:
self.addr=self.addr6
except:
pass
try: try:
a=self.addr4 a=self.addr4
a=self.addr6
except: except:
print "fix %s: addr to addr4/6 fixup" % self.name print "fix %s: addr to addr4/6 fixup" % self.name
if isIPv4(self.addr): if isIPv4(self.addr):
self.addr4 = self.addr self.addr4 = self.addr
self.addr6 = None
else: else:
self.addr4 = None
self.addr6 = self.addr self.addr6 = self.addr
del self.addr del self.addr